CTD 12.5mg Tablet, containing Chlorthalidone 12.5mg, is a diuretic, also known as a 'water pill', primarily prescribed to manage hypertension (high blood pressure) and reduce fluid retention (edema) linked to heart, liver, kidney, or lung conditions.
This medicine works by helping your body eliminate excess water through urine. CTD 12.5mg Tablet can be used alone or in combination with other medications. To avoid frequent nighttime urination, it's generally recommended to take CTD 12.5mg Tablet during the daytime. Always follow your doctor's prescribed dose and duration for CTD 12.5mg Tablet; never stop taking it abruptly without medical advice. Many individuals with high blood pressure may not experience symptoms, but discontinuing the medication can worsen your condition, potentially leading to increased blood pressure and a higher risk of heart disease and stroke.
Regular blood pressure monitoring is crucial while taking CTD 12.5mg Tablet. This medication is part of a comprehensive treatment plan that should also include a healthy diet, regular exercise, smoking cessation, moderate alcohol intake, and weight management. While taking CTD 12.5mg Tablet, you can maintain a normal diet but should aim to reduce salt intake.
Common side effects of CTD 12.5mg Tablet include headache, nausea, and dizziness. If these side effects become bothersome, consult your doctor. Before starting CTD 12.5mg Tablet, inform your doctor about any existing kidney or liver conditions. Pregnant women and breastfeeding mothers should also seek medical advice before using this medication. It is essential to disclose all other medicines you are currently taking to your doctor.'

Uses:
- Managing Hypertension (High Blood Pressure) with Ctd 12.5mg Tablet
- Treating Edema (Fluid Retention) with Ctd 12.5mg Tablet
Directions of Use
Take Ctd 12.5mg Tablet exactly as prescribed by your doctor, following the recommended dose and duration. Swallow the tablet whole without chewing, crushing, or breaking it. Ctd 12.5mg Tablet should be taken with food.
Side effects
Potential Side Effects of Ctd 12.5mg Tablet
Most side effects associated with Ctd 12.5mg Tablet are generally mild and temporary, often resolving as your body adjusts to the medication. However, if any of these side effects persist or cause concern, please consult your doctor.
- Headache
- Nausea
- Dizziness
